Our services cover a wide spectrum of medical waste disposal, including:

  • General Medical Waste: Safe removal of daily clinical waste.
  • Chemotherapy Waste: Specialized handling for oncology-related materials.
  • Pathological Waste: Secure disposal of biological tissues.
  • Pharmaceutical Waste: Proper management of expired or unused medications.
  • Hazardous Waste: Disposal of toxic substances and chemicals.
  • Universal Waste: Handling of batteries, light bulbs, and similar items.
  • Document Destruction: Secure shredding to protect confidential information.
